Dore M.H. Water Policy in Canada: Problems and Possible Solutions
Springer, 2015. – 343 pp.
The value of this book is much enhanced by the inclusion of several chapters that deal specifically with provincial water policies in Canada. It is not just serious readers who will find much of interest in these chapters. In light of the comparative lessons they provide they will be of great value to provincial government regulators who may wish to re-examine their regulatory policies in the light of lessons from other jurisdictions outlined in this book.
This is an important book that has appeared at a critical juncture in the history of water policy in Canada. It provides an opportunity to examine what worked and what has not worked elsewhere in the world so that we can avoid spending billions of dollars on public policy actions that appear to reform water resource management habits but in fact only perpetuate current circumstances while worsening scarcity in the future. This book provides a blueprint for making water management practice consistent with policy promise in Canada. It is a blueprint worth following.
